Assessing Your Power Needs and Usage
Just how do you identify your power needs prior to installing a solar system? Start by evaluating your previous electrical energy expenses.
Seek your regular monthly usage in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the in 2014; this'll provide you a strong average. Next, think about any changes you plan to make, like including new home appliances or an electric lorry, as these will certainly impact your future energy needs.
You must additionally analyze the efficiency of your home-- inadequate insulation or old home appliances can raise power usage.
Ultimately, consider your lifestyle behaviors; for example, if you're usually home throughout the day, you could need a bigger system to cover daytime usage.
Understanding Different Types of Solar Solutions
After examining your power requires, it's important to explore the various types of planetary systems offered.
You'll normally encounter 3 main alternatives: grid-tied, off-grid, and crossbreed systems. Grid-tied systems connect straight to the utility grid, permitting you to offer excess energy back. They're typically the most affordable choice if you have reputable grid access.
Off-grid systems operate individually, needing battery storage to supply power throughout outages or low sunlight. These are suitable for remote locations yet can be a lot more expensive.
Hybrid systems incorporate both, giving you the versatility of battery storage space while still connecting to the grid. Each kind has its advantages, so consider your lifestyle, area, and energy goals when making your choice.
